Sign up or log in to MY NTS and get personalised recommendations
Support NTS for timestamps across live channels and the archive
The Odd Couple is the duo of rappers Louis Logic and Jay-Love, with only one album to date and likely the only as Louis Logic was quoted saying that there would never be another. It received only moderate reviews and mild attention.
The album was released on 11/18/2004 on Brick Records featuring Production by JJ Brown and The Avid Collector, released on Vinyl and CD with a single on Vinyl of 'Wreckyalife/ Between Your Legs".
Thanks!
Your suggestion has been successfully submitted.